Three: Sub Lieutenant J. L. Oates, Royal Naval Volunteer Reserve, 188th Trench Mortar Battery R.N. Division, killed in action, 13 November 1916

1914-15 Star (S. Lt., R.N.V.R.); British War and Victory Medals (S. Lt., R.N.V.R.) nearly extremely fine (3) £350-400

Sub Lieutenant Joshua Laurence Oates, R.N.V.R., 188th Trench Mortar Battery, R.N. Division, was killed in action on 13 November 1916, aged 22 years. Having no known grave, his name is commemorated on the Thiepval Memorial. He was the son of the late Joshua and Phoebe Oates. Before the war he had been a Dental Student at Guy’s Hospital, London.
